THE DOCTORS IN GENERAL: All Doctors need to rest in the staff room for
a certain period of time to allow them to recuperate from their hard
day at work. If you set the Send Staff To Staff Room level too high,
the Doctors (not to mention all the other staff) will get tired, mad,
make mistakes, demand pay rises, and eventually quit. Set the Send
Staff To Staff Room level to about twenty or twenty-five percent and
they will never demand pay rises or get mad.

All Doctors come with a certain level of training. Starting from the
fourth level, you can train your Doctors to higher skill levels. All
you need to do this is a Training Room and a Consultant (discussed
later). Put both in the Training Room (making sure that their tiredness
level is at zero). Also make sure that the Staff Room is close to them,
or else the training of a Doctor will take longer. It is a good idea to
have lots of Bookcases and Skeletons in your Training Rooms, due to the
fact that it speeds up the training time. Another important fact is
that the more Doctors you train at once in a single Training Room, the
less the speed they will learn at. Like, if you have one Doctor being
taught on a one-on-one basis, he will learn at a rate three times
faster than that of the same Training Room with three Doctors in it.

There are three types of Doctors: Junior, Doctor, and Consultant. A
Junior is a Doctor with hardly any training, so you should train them
to get them to an acceptable level of skill. The main advantage of
hiring Juniors is that they are VERY cheap, and you can train them for
free. A Doctor is a Doctor with a skill level that is about in the
middle or a little above that. Doctors cost a little more than Juniors,
but less than Consultants. Doctors and Juniors have no special
features. Consultants, on the other hand, are glorified Doctors. Their
skill level is extremely high, and they can be used to train young
Doctors and Juniors to acceptable levels. Consultants cost a LOT of
money, and the more special skills they possess (like a Surgeon), they
will pass that skill on to their students. Also, the more Doctors and
Juniors work in your hospital, the more knowledge and skill they
obtain. They eventually will become Consultants if they are working in
your hospital for long enough. You should make sure that all staff
possess a moderate to high level if Attention to Detail (specified when
you hire them). If they don't, they will make more mistakes. But you
can train them and Attention to Detail won't really matter then.
